ChatGPT TLDR: What’s Happening in Sudan? Sudan is in a brutal civil war between two groups: SAF (Sudanese Army) RSF (Rapid Support Forces, a paramilitary group) Who’s Involved Behind the Scenes? Turkey backs the Sudanese Army (SAF) Sending drones and weapons. Has business and political interests in Sudan. Wants access to Red Sea ports and gold. UAE backs the RSF Secretly sends weapons disguised as aid. Accused of supporting war crimes. Also wants influence over Sudan's resources and ports. Why Are They Fighting? Turkey and the UAE are using Sudan to compete for power and resources in Africa and the Red Sea region. What’s the Result? Over 150,000 people killed. 12 million displaced. Widespread famine and war crimes. The war keeps going because of foreign support on both sides. In short: Turkey and the UAE turned Sudan’s war into a secret proxy battle for influence, money, and land — with devastating human consequences.
